<h3 style="text-align: center"><strong>They&#39;re All Gone Now</strong></h3>
<p>THE LAST KNOWN SURVIVING UNIFORMED VETERAN OF WORLD WAR I has passed away in England.&nbsp; It was announced today (Tuesday) that Florence Green of King&#39;s Lynn died in her sleep&nbsp;in a nursing home on Saturday, just two weeks shy of her 111th birthday.</p>
<p>According to published news releases,&nbsp; Green joined the fledgling Royal Air Force in September 1918 at age 17 and served as a mess steward at two air bases in Norfolk.&nbsp; Two months later the Armistice was signed ending the war, but she continued in the RAF until the following July.</p>
<p>The dear lady never mentioned her service in later years until a researcher at the UK military archives discovered her records.&nbsp; On her 109th birthday the RAF honored her with a visit from a wing commander and a representative mess steward of today who brought a cake.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/02/07/last-surviving-veteran-of-world-war-i-passes/florence-green-a-minofdef/" rel="attachment wp-att-80927"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-80927" height="335"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/02/florence-green-a-minofdef.jpg" title="florence green a minofdef" width="402"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>Mess Steward Hannah Shaw visited Florence in 2010<br />
	to help celebrate her 109th birthday.&nbsp; (Ministry of Defence photo)</em></p>
<p>Her mind was alert and nimble right to the end.&nbsp; On her 110th birthday someone asked her what it was like to be that old, and she replied, &quot;It&#39;s not much different than being 109, I guess.&quot;&nbsp; Her husband Walter died in 1970 and since then she lived with her oldest daughter, now 90, until&nbsp;the end of this past&nbsp;November&nbsp;when she entered the nursing home.</p>

<h3 style="text-align: center"><strong>Untold Hundreds Injured</strong></h3>
<p>AT LEAST 74 PEOPLE WERE KILLED and hundreds more injured when a riot broke out at a soccer game in Port Said, Egypt, Wednesday night&nbsp; The home team, el Masry from Port Said had just won its match against el Ahley, a superior and favored team from Cairo, 3-1, when hundreds of &quot;fans&quot; poured out of the stands onto the soccer pitch and began brawling.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/02/01/74-dead-in-self-inflicted-mass-casualty-incident/egypt-b-xinhua/" rel="attachment wp-att-80581"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-80581" height="248"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/02/egypt-b-xinhua.jpg" title="egypt b xinhua" width="402"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>Xinhua</em></p>
<p>The players from the two teams ran to the safety of the locker rooms with the assistance of stadium security people, but two players were still injured before they could get off the field.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/02/01/74-dead-in-self-inflicted-mass-casualty-incident/egypt-a-el-ahly-xinhua/" rel="attachment wp-att-80582"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-80582" height="266"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/02/egypt-a-el-ahly-xinhua.jpg" title="egypt a el-ahly xinhua" width="400"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>el-Ahly players run for their lives to the locker rooms&nbsp; (Xinhua)</em></p>
<p>This video posted by Youm7 News opens with the el Ahley players being chased off the field:</p>
<p style="text-align: center">&nbsp;<iframe allowfullscreen="" frameborder="0" height="315" src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/y3p10DiII4k" width="420"></iframe></p>
<p><a href="http://news.xinhuanet.com/english/world/2012-02/02/c_122643340.htm" target="_blank">Xinhua News reports</a>:</p>
<blockquote>
<p>Due to insufficient security, most of the fans entered the stadium with sticks in their hands and supporters of the two rival teams started fighting each other.</p>
<p>The riot was caused by some insulting posters carried by the Ahly fans, Nile TV reported. One of the posters read &quot;Port Said is like rubbish and it has no men.&quot;</p>
<p>Chief of Egypt&#39;s ruling Supreme Council of the Armed Forces, Hussein Tantawi, ordered two military helicopters to transfer the players, fans and the injured to the capital Cairo.</p>
<p>Egyptian Prosecutor General Abdel Maguid Mahmoud ordered an investigation into the riot. The parliament will hold an emergency session Thursday over the incident.</p>
</blockquote>
<p>The rioting spilled out of the stadium into the surround streets forcing shops to close and bar their doors.</p>
<p>In Cairo, another match was being held between Zamalik and Ismaily.&nbsp; During their half-time break, news of the riot in Port Said was delivered to the stadium officials and it was decided to cancel the second half of the match in case the rioters were planning on spreading the protest to the other stadium.&nbsp; When it was announced to the fans in attendance that the rest of the match was cancelled, they began to riot, setting fires throughout the stadium.</p>
<p>The chief of the military police vowed to track down those responsible and arrest them.</p>

<p style="text-align: center"><strong>Onerous Residency Law Forces Action.</strong></p>
<p>THE ST. LOUIS, MISSOURI, FIREFIGHTERS are in a jam thanks to the city&#39;s oppressive residency requirements.&nbsp; St. Louis, like many other failed cities, requires its employees to live inside the city.&nbsp; These laws are usually a tactic to keep more of the taxpayers on the public payroll instead of being shunted aside by better-qualified people who don&#39;t live in the city.&nbsp; This has a bad effect on firefighters and police officers who traditionally&nbsp;will sacrifice their own comfort and abide by the law in order to keep a job that they really love and do well.</p>
<p>The hang-up for most younger workers in the city is the fact that the school systems in these places are just as bad or worse than the rest of the city government and the employees do not want to send their children to non-productive public schools.&nbsp; The St. Louis schools are so bad that they have lost their state accreditation.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/25/st-louis-firefighters-go-to-court-to-get-their-children-into-school/st-lou-pubschool-logo/" rel="attachment wp-att-80016"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-80016" height="100"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/st-lou-pubschool-logo.jpg" title="st lou pubschool logo" width="150" /></a></p>
<p><em>The St. Louis Beacon</em> tells, <i>&#8230;. because the firefighters have to live in the city, their choice is between unaccredited public schools, charter schools or private or parochial schools that charge tuition.&nbsp; </i><i>If the choice is to pay tuition, the bill can be a hefty one. Wayne Killingsworth said he is paying more than $20,000 a year for his children to attend parochial schools.</i></p>
<p>Missouri has a state law that requires surrounding jurisdictions to accept students from municipalities that don&#39;t have accredited schools into their schools and the tuition and transportation&nbsp;costs are to be borne by the home jurisdiction.</p>
<p>But the couties surrounding St. Louis are balking at accepting the foreign students and now five firefighters have filed a suit asking the court to force the school districts to obey the law and allow them to enroll their children.&nbsp; Again from the Beacon:</p>
<blockquote>
<p>Ryan, who was rebuffed in his effort to enroll his child in Kirkwood, said he doesn&#39;t mind having to live in the city, but he doesn&#39;t think his child&#39;s education should suffer.</p>
<p>&quot;I would prefer to remain in the city and have my daughter attend an accredited school,&quot; he said, adding that instead, she is &quot;trapped in a failed district.&quot;</p>
<p>&quot;All we are asking,&quot; Ryan added, &quot;is that the Outstanding Schools Act be enforced as written. We don&#39;t want the future to be unpredictable when it comes to our daughter&#39;s education.&quot;</p>
</blockquote>
<p>IAFF Local 73 is supporting their challenge.</p>

<p style="text-align: center"><strong>Pair of Notorious Guns Auctioned Off Saturday</strong></p>
<p>TWO GUNS LEFT BEHIND BY BONNIE &amp; CLYDE when a police raid on their Joplin, Missouri&nbsp;apartment caused them to flee, were sold at a Kansas City auction house Saturday for $210,000.</p>
<p>On Friday <a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/20/bonnies-and-clydes-guns-to-be-sold-saturday/" target="_blank"><strong>Firegeezer REPORTED HERE</strong></a> on the upcoming auction and we included some brief history on the two firearms, one a Thompson submachine gun and the other a 12-gauge Winchester shotgun.&nbsp; The machine gun is the only &quot;Tommy&quot; gun that the Barrow gang is known to have carried.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/23/bonnies-tommy-gun-brings-130-grand/gun-a-tommy-2/" rel="attachment wp-att-79912"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79912" height="216"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/gun-a-tommy1.jpg" title="gun a tommy" width="400"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>Mayo Auction photo</em></p>
<p>The guns were seized by the raiding policemen on&nbsp;April 13, 1933,&nbsp;and kept as spoils by one of them who later gave them to the great-grandfather of the people who sold them this week.&nbsp; This marked the first time they had ever been sold since they were stolen and kept by Bonnie Parker and Clyde Barrow.</p>
<p>Both items were sold fairly quickly and the same bidder won both guns, paying $130,000 for the Thompson and $80,000 for the Winchester.&nbsp; The successful telephone bidder was not identified publicly other than as &quot;an East Coast gun collector.&quot;</p>
<p>This brief video shows the guns on display at the auction room just prior to the sale:</p>
<p style="text-align: center">&nbsp;<iframe allowfullscreen="" frameborder="0" height="315" src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/BBZ-JDoSNDs" width="560"></iframe></p>
<p>For more information on the guns&#39; histories, refer to the Firegeezer story <a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/20/bonnies-and-clydes-guns-to-be-sold-saturday/" target="_blank"><strong>HERE</strong></a>.</p>
<p>In an article on the sale after its conclusion, the <em>Joplin Globe</em> wrote:</p>
<blockquote>
<p>The weapons are believed to be among those seized after a raid April 13, 1933, at the outlaws&rsquo; apartment hideout near 34th Street and Oak Ridge Drive in Joplin.</p>
<p>Five lawmen in two cars, armed only with handguns, descended on the apartment, and a bloody gunfight ensued. Two of the lawmen &mdash; Newton County Constable John Wesley Harryman and Joplin police Detective Harry McGinnis &mdash; were killed. Clyde Barrow, Buck Barrow and fellow gang member W.D. &quot;Deacon&quot; Jones were injured.</p>
<p>After the raid, police confiscated guns, a camera and personal items from the apartment, which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2009. The film in the camera, which was developed by The Joplin Globe at the time, was of special interest. The images on the film, which include some with the guns, were the first to identify the outlaws. Historians say the publication of those images in newspapers across the country spelled the beginning of the end for the duo.</p>
</blockquote>

<h3 style="text-align: center"><strong>The &quot;Me&quot; Generation Rolls Right Along</strong></h3>
<p>DEMONSTRATING THAT THE NARCISSISM of the &quot;It&#39;s all about ME!&quot; generation has no bounds, an Illinois man posted an x-ray of his brain injury on his Facebook page while he was being rushed to the hospital for emergency surgery.</p>
<p>This past Tuesday, Dante Autullo of Orland Park, Illinois, was using a nail gun while building a shed.&nbsp; At one point, while working on an overhead portion, he felt a little punch but no other sensation and presumed that an errant nail had grazed his skull right where a small wound appeared.&nbsp; So he kept on working.&nbsp; Wednesday morning when&nbsp; he woke up, he felt nauseous and thought he should see a doctor.&nbsp;</p>
<p>Later that afternoon he went into a hospital ER where they took an x-ray and found a 3-&frac14; &quot; nail embedded in his brain.&nbsp; The AP report explains that while there are pain-sensitive nerves on a person&#39;s skull, there aren&#39;t any within the brain itself. That&#39;s why he would have felt the nail strike the skull, but he wouldn&#39;t have felt it penetrate the brain.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/21/should-facebook-ride-the-ambulance-with-you/nail-brain/" rel="attachment wp-att-79761"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79761" height="306"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/nail-brain.jpg" title="nail brain" width="400"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>Image provided by AP</em></p>
<p>The ER docs packaged him up and sent him via ambulance to another hospital better suited for brain surgery.&nbsp; While en route between hospitals, Autullo (presumably with the assistance of his girlfriend) took a snapshot of the x-ray and posted it directly on his Facebook page for all the world to see (him).</p>
<p>The 2-hour surgery was successful and he has full use of his limbs and thinking process, so he has good reason to be grateful.&nbsp; The AP story continues:</p>
<blockquote>
<p>Neurosurgeon Leslie Schaffer acknowledged that Autullo&#39;s case was unusual, but not extremely rare. Schaffer said having a nail penetrate the skull is not like being shot in the head, noting that a bullet would break into multiple pieces.</p>
<p>&quot;This [the nail] is thinner, with a small trajectory, and pointed at the end,&quot; he said. &quot;The bone doesn&#39;t fracture much because the nail has a small tip.&quot;</p>
<p>Schaffer said the man&#39;s skull stopped the nail from going farther into his brain. He said he removed the nail by putting two holes in Autullo&#39;s skull, on either side of the nail, then pulled the nail out along with a piece of the skull. The part of the skull that was removed for surgery was replaced with a titanium mesh, Hospital spokesman Mike Maggio said.</p>
</blockquote>

<h3 style="text-align: center"><strong>Cultural Artifacts on the Auction Block</strong></h3>
<p>SERIOUS GUN COLLECTORS (AND FANS) ARE streaming into Kansas City today so that they can attend the Mayo Auction &amp; Realty Co.&#39;s major firearm auction on Saturday.&nbsp; More than 100 firearms on consignment will be sold beginning at 10 am.</p>
<p>The star offerings in this show are two guns owned by the infamous Bonnie Parker&nbsp;&amp; Clyde Barrow, the Depression-Era criminals who traveled the mid-west holding up banks and killing nine police officers along with dozens of innocent civilians.</p>
<p>The weapons coming on the block are a Thompson sub-machine gun treasured and used by Bonnie Parker that was the only &quot;Tommy&quot; gun that the gang ever owned.&nbsp; The other is a 12-gauge Winchester shotgun model 1897.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/20/bonnies-and-clydes-guns-to-be-sold-saturday/gun-a-tommy/" rel="attachment wp-att-79682"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79682" height="216"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/gun-a-tommy.jpg" title="gun a tommy" width="400"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>all photos via Mayo Auctions</em></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/20/bonnies-and-clydes-guns-to-be-sold-saturday/gun-b-shotgun/" rel="attachment wp-att-79683"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79683" height="105"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/gun-b-shotgun.jpg" title="gun b shotgun" width="400" /></a></em></p>
<p>The guns were left behind in a Joplin, Missouri, hotel room when police raided the gang.&nbsp; They escaped by a hair, but left behind a weapons cache and a camera.&nbsp; One of the raiding officers took the Tommy gun and the 12-gauge along with the camera for souvenirs.&nbsp; When the film in the camera was developed, the photos were of the couple in various &quot;crime guy and moll&quot; poses that have since become iconic.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/20/bonnies-and-clydes-guns-to-be-sold-saturday/bc/" rel="attachment wp-att-79684"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79684" height="309"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/bc.jpg" title="b&amp;c" width="431" /></a></p>
<p>According to Mayo Auctions, the sellers&#39; great-grandfather, M. L. Lairmore who was in law enforcement at the time, was given the two guns by another peace officer who had seized the weapons after a raid on the pair in Joplin, Missouri in April of 1933<b>.</b></p>
<p>The guns have been in the family of Mark Lairmore and his sisters, the sellers, from Springfield, MO., ever since the unknown Depression-era police officer gave them to their great-grandfather.&nbsp; For the past 35 years they have been on loan to the Springfield, Missouri, Police Department&#39;s museum where they have been on display.&nbsp; The family has now decided to sell the weapons and consigned them to this auction to be held on January 21.</p>

<h3 style="text-align: center"><strong>Friday Morning &#8211; The Music World Mourns Today</strong></h3>
<p>Johnny Otis died Tuesday, it was announced yesterday.&nbsp;&nbsp;The Rock&nbsp;&amp; Roll Hall of Famer&nbsp;was 90 years old and largely unknown to the current generation that is under 50 years of age.&nbsp; But he was a giant in the music world during his heyday as a songwriter, performer, disc jockey, band leader, record producer and on and on.</p>
<p>Born John Veliotes&nbsp;in December 1921 to Greek immigrant parents, his father ran a grocery store in a predominantly black neighborhood of Berkeley, California, where he became immersed in the black music culture and steered his personal ambitions in that direction.&nbsp; He began his career as a drummer in a&nbsp;Rhythm&nbsp;&amp; Blues&nbsp;band and started writing songs also, many of them becoming standards in the R &amp; B genre such as <em>So Fine</em> and <em>All Night Long</em>.&nbsp; It was in 1958 that he wrote and recorded the monster hit that made his fame nationwide, <em>Willie and the Hand Jive</em>.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/20/morning-lineup-january-20-5/otis-b-reuters-2/" rel="attachment wp-att-79625"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79625" height="121"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/otis-b-reuters1.jpg" title="otis b reuters" width="152" /></a></p>
<p>As a record producer and D.J. he &quot;discovered&quot; several budding performers and set them on the path to stardom, inluding Hank Ballard, Etta James, Little Richard, and Jackie Wilson, to name just a few.&nbsp; His accomplishments led to his introduction into the Rock &amp; Roll Hall of Fame in 1994 and was as deserving as any others enshrined.</p>
<p>We are fortunate that his early &quot;music video&quot; of him performing his signature song <em>Willie and the Hand Jive</em> has been preserved and posted on YouTube.&nbsp; Otis is the singer and pianist in this classic performance:</p>

<h3 style="text-align: center"><strong>Florida?&nbsp; Who Knew?</strong></h3>
<p>ONE OF THE OLDEST TREES IN THE WORLD, a 3,500 yr.-old bald cypress located in Seminole County, Florida, burned down Monday.&nbsp; The National Landmark long known as The Senator was discovered burning in the morning and initial speculation held that a set brush fire did it in.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/16/pre-historic-tree-burns-in-florida/cypress-c-burning/" rel="attachment wp-att-79427"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79427" height="268"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/cypress-c-burning.jpg" title="cypress c burning" width="302"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>WKMP image</em></p>
<p>But after it collapsed this afternoon a chief forestry fire investigator&nbsp;could look inside the trunk and he immediately ruled out the arson theory.&nbsp; &quot;The thought now is that the fire was due to a lighting strike about two weeks ago,&quot; said Steve Wright, a spokesman for the Seminole County Fire Rescue. &quot;We think it was smoldering inside the tree and we only saw the blaze today, when it reached the top.&quot;</p>
<p>A visitor to the state park where the tree is located spotted the fire and called the FD shortly before 6 am.&nbsp; The expanded dispatch brought tankers while the firefighters hand-laid over 800 ft. of lines to the tree.&nbsp; At 7:45 am a 20-ft. section fell off the top and 45 minutes later more of the trunk collapsed.&nbsp;</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/16/pre-historic-tree-burns-in-florida/cypress-a-hulk-orlandosentinel/" rel="attachment wp-att-79428"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79428" height="341"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/cypress-a-hulk-orlandosentinel.jpg" title="cypress a hulk orlandosentinel" width="452"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>Only a smoldering stump remains after the last section of<br />
	the trunk collapsed this morning.&nbsp; (Orlando Sentinel photo)</em></p>
<p>The tree once stood about 165 ft. high, but a 1925 hurricane took off the top 45 ft. leaving a 116-ft. trunk since then.&nbsp; The property that is now the Big Tree State Park was donated to the state by Florida State Senator Moses Overstreet, hence the tree&#39;s nickname.&nbsp; In 1946 the American Forestry Association bored a hole in the trunk to remove a test core and found the age to be 3,500 years.&nbsp; A companion tree is not far from The Senator that remains today and is 2,000 years old.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/16/pre-historic-tree-burns-in-florida/cypress-b-trunk-1920-floridaarchives-2/" rel="attachment wp-att-79430"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79430" height="302"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/cypress-b-trunk-1920-floridaarchives1.jpg" title="cypress b trunk 1920 floridaarchives" width="402"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><em>Two men pose in front of The Senator in this 1920&#39;s photo<br />
	from the Florida State Archives to illustrate the size of the trunk. </em></p>

<p style="text-align: center"><strong>Wednesday Morning &#8211; What Shall I Put This In?</strong></p>
<p>Things are always changing as time marches on.&nbsp; New products are developed that replace old favorites and existing materials are improved to the point where they assume new uses that make others obsolete.&nbsp; For example, think about the basic jar that foodstuffs come in.&nbsp; I have a nice large glass jar that holds about 28 or 30 ounces by measure of liquid or dry product.&nbsp; This one, in fact, had originally been used for some artificial coffee creamer sold in grocery stores.&nbsp; I have been using it for probably 25 or 30 years now to keep uncooked rice in my pantry.&nbsp; It is made of a very heavy glass and the lid is relatively thick steel.&nbsp; A grand, sturdy container that can easily last another 30 years.&nbsp;</p>
<p>Those were common on grocery shelves for all kinds of products, but now you can&#39;t find a one.&nbsp; Everything is plastic now, even the lids.&nbsp; And they don&#39;t seem to have that durability of the old glass containers or nice steel cans like coffee used to come in.&nbsp; And we always need small containers for this and that, but our ability to get them is limited now.&nbsp; Variety and craft stores even sell empty jars and wooden boxes for people who need them but can no longer just wash out one that they got for free.&nbsp; Such a shame.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://firegeezer.com/2012/01/11/morning-lineup-january-11-5/cigar-box-b/" rel="attachment wp-att-79112"><img alt=""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-79112" height="264" src="http://firegeezer.com/files/2012/01/cigar-box-b.jpg" title="cigar box b" width="300" /></a></p>
<p>None of these practical containers of the past is probably more missed than the classic cigar box.&nbsp; Those wooden boxes are just the right size for hundreds of uses and can survive being dropped.&nbsp; They also stack very nicely.&nbsp; Most people under the age of 40 have probably never even seen one, let alone possessed one to keep cherished items in.&nbsp; For one thing, the number of people who smoke cigars has dropped precipitously and there are far fewer cigar boxes being made.&nbsp; And they certainly don&#39;t have the look and feel that the old ones do.</p>
<p>When I was a child, they were easy to come by.&nbsp; All you had to do was go to the local drug store and ask the cashier where the tobacco counter was located, and if they had an empty they would willingly hand it over.&nbsp; Kids have lots of uses for a cigar box, such as keeping a coin collection or pile of toy cars.&nbsp; Grown-ups like them too, for things like a handy sewing kit or small tool box for the kitchen.&nbsp; Even canceled checks fit nicely in them.&nbsp; But now they don&#39;t even send your check back to you.&nbsp; The boxes are made of wood&#8230;..thin strips that are glued together and covered inside and out with a heavy printed paper.&nbsp; The double layer of paper served as the hinge for the lid which was always snug-fitting.</p>
<p>Cigar boxes were made by the millions and there are still plenty of them around if you want a couple for yourself.&nbsp; A check with eBay shows nearly 9,000 of them for sale today, most of them in the $5 range which is not a bad price for such a handy item.&nbsp; It&#39;s a shame when progress races along and leaves such valuable things behind like good glass jars and cigar boxes.</p>
